Position Overview
This is a hands-on opportunity for someone with basic carpentry experience who wants to build real-world skills in a unique outdoor setting. You’ll work directly on meaningful projects that contribute to the guest experience—from interior finishing to outdoor installations.
Key Responsibilities
Assist with the construction, repair, and finishing of cabins, decks, and other wooden structures.
Participate in site preparation tasks such as material handling, cleanup, and workspace organization.
Assist with finishing interior walls (paneling, trim, drywall touch-ups)
Install cabinetry, shelving, and built-in features
Construct and install outdoor signage and structures
Support general carpentry and light construction projects
Maintain tools, materials, and a clean, safe work environment
Work with environmentally sensitive practices appropriate for a nature-based retreat.
Collaborate with the team to problem-solve and execute design ideas
Requirements
Some carpentry experience (education, apprenticeship, or hands-on work)
Basic knowledge of hand and power tools
Strong attention to detail and craftsmanship
Ability to work independently and as part of a team
Physically capable of lifting materials and working outdoors in varying conditions
Valid driver’s license is an asset
